Control: tags -1 wontfix

Upstream does not want to move to another toolkit, so when GTK 2 is removed, ardour has to go as
well. I guess we should at least keep ardour-lv2-plugins.

It is also the only very popular package that hinders gtkmm2.4 removal so I suggest to reduce it to
build only ardour-lv2-plugins for trixie.

Do we have anything in the archive that comes close to ardour and that we can suggest to people as a
replacement? lmms? qtractor?

Ardour 8.3 has been released and no longer depends on deprecated GTK2 as
a modified version is bundled within. https://ardour.org/whatsnew83.html

Considering ardour has been scheduled for autoremoval on 06 March
(#1061203), I highly recommend getting this updated as soon as possible
to avoid this removal. Since the library is now bundled, the dependency
on libgtk2.0-dev can be dropped.
